ROUTINES. BE FLEXIBLE

Babies have a wonderful sense of humour. Just as you think they have a routine going, they go and change it!

Last night the little boy I was looking after slept through the night, but decided that getting up time was 5.30am.
No matter how I tried to settle him, he would have none of it.

So, at 6.30 he accompanied me as I got dressed and we went downstairs and he had his breakfast at 7.30 as usual.

So, with a little adjustment by myself, he was back in routine again and settled for his morning nap at the usual time.

The lesson being; sometimes it is better to be flexible and not stressed about something out of your control, but work towards easing things back to normal.
After all, as they get bigger the routine will change.

I feel the most important thing is to keep the schedule as normal as possible. Babies (like adults), like to know what comes next, just as we do; and in this case - breakfast, play, nap).
